MJA twin box open

502034 at Crewe Basford Hall in June 2013. ©Dan Adkins

The fleet of MJA wagons were produced exclusively for Freightliner in the early 2000s. Primarily used for the transport of stone, minerals and aggregates, the wagons are almost always operated in pairs with buffers at one end and a bar coupling used at the other end. These vehicles are still widely used today, including on workings between Mountsorrel to Luton and Croft to Harwich. GB Railfreight have taken ownership of a number of MJA wagons and operate them alongside Freightliner.

Type of Vehicle

Hopper Wagon

Builder

Wagony Swidnica, Poland

Build Dates

2003 to 2004

Total Built

60

Wheel Configuration

Bogies

Operated By

Freightliner
GB Railfreight

Main Duties

Stone, Minerals & Aggregates Transport

In Service Until

Present

Surviving Examples

60
